Explanation:
The European Union was formed shortly after the end of the World War II. The reason for the formation of this organization was to promote economic support and development between the nations, as well as political unity, thus future conflicts to be prevented on the continent. The organization started off in Western Europe with only handful of members, but it gradually started to include other European nations in it, and nowadays there are more country members of the European Union in Europe, than countries that are not members of it.

After World War II ended in 1945, Europe was divided into Western Europe and Eastern Europe by the Iron Curtain. Western Europe promoted capitalist democracies, and Eastern Europe came under the Communist influence of the Soviet Union
